The referee who will blow the whistle this coming Friday is the first of two matches of Spain classification for eurocup of next summer. Appointment to Georgia after the victory against Norway and the difficult win against Scotland. The match will be whistled by German Daniel Siebert (39 years old), who has been refereeing in the Bundesliga since 2015.
From the UEFA Elite group, he was one of the referees who attended the World Cup in Qatar where he whistled one of the most controversial matches and ended Uruguay’s elimination against Ghana. That game left us with rojiblanco Giménez’s complaints on camera or Cavanni’s touch gesture on the VAR monitor.
This is the first time he has whistled for the Spanish team, which he has so far managed in the Sub21 and Sub19 categories. As for the Spanish teams, the last one that came before was Sevilla last season in the first leg of the Europa League semifinals. It was played in Turin against Juventus, a match that ended in a draw to one. Villarreal was the Spanish team that blew the whistle the most times, three times in total. This is also the first time he whistled for Georgia at the international level.
The German is one of the referees with the biggest projections for UEFA and Germany. He was the referee of the last German Cup final between RB Leipzig and Eintracht Frankfurt.
